How on earth has a T-reg Sprinter survived this long, especially in Scotland?  It should be just glass and plastic left by now.

With TV sat trucks, the cost of the underlying van is almost irrelevant - the dish on the top alone will cost more than the Merc. So they're brim full of waxoyl and maintained very well to get them to last as long as possible. It's only when the TV equipment gets obsolete that they tend to be retired.

 

In a similar vein my old radio station is running an X-reg 807.
